Transaction 6fbca0452ab62bce88f2d48864051cd26d5400ceeebbce3a1f9e825989037365
1 Input
1 Output
-
6fbca0452ab62bce88f2d48864051cd26d5400ceeebbce3a1f9e825989037365:0
- value
- 21597279
- script pubkey
- OP_0 OP_PUSHBYTES_20 ded73533ded61f594e36611cf6c0d646d29022a5
- address
- bc1qmmtn2v776c04jn3kvyw0dsxkgmffqg49h3qsat